La Scarpetta
Balloch Road, Balloch, Alexandria, nr Dumbarton, G83 8SS [Map]
It's not uncommon to see plenty of tourists at La Scarpetta, probably because of its location in Balloch, the gateway to The Highlands, on the banks of Loch Lomond. And it's only natural to see the kitchen, relying on the abundance of Scotland's natural larder, applying focus to Italian regions like Ciociaria, Abruzzese and Campania, endorsing a more Southern style of cooking.
One look at the menu and you're sure to catch the involvement of local ingredients, a made to order warm seafood salad of tiger and king prawns, whitebait and squid, dressed with freshly squeezed lemon on a bed of mixed salad bears testament to that. The signature pollo saltimbocca stuffed with Parma ham and mozzarella, pan-fried in butter and served with Marsala sauce makes an impression, and so does a fillet villa Roma, pan-fried steak with onions, mushroom, cream, whisky, mustard and red wine.
The house wine at La Scarpetta is reasonably priced and available by the small and not-so-small glass and bottle.

Cafe Albert at Gargunnock Inn
6 Main Street, Gargunnock, Stirling, FK8 3BW [Map]
Gargunnock Inn is a family run inn with a warm and welcoming atmosphere. The interior features exposed brick work, wooden bar tops and a traditional feel with modern touches. The dining room is decorated like a large lounge with soft lighting. The venue has a small beer garden to the rear where you can enjoy a quiet drink after a long day with your loved one. This fun filled place offers a unique dining experience with regular theme evenings and live music.
The menu offers traditional pub food with an à la carte specials board changing weekly, and favourites with a touch of class made from fresh local produce, including game. The country style lounge bar also serves bar meals with weekly changing real ales and a wide selection of wines.
Choose from a range of dishes such as Scottish smoked salmon and prawn platter, breast of duck with blackcurrant sauce and beef steaks.

Waterfront Restaurant at The Lake of Menteith Hotel
Lake of Menteith Hotel, Port of Menteith, nr Aberfoyle, FK8 3RA [Map]
Lake of Menteith Hotel and Waterfront Restaurant is a unique hotel in a very special location; redeveloped over three years by Ian Fleming, it was relaunched in early 2008. It is decorated in the warm and welcoming style of a classic New England waterfront hotel with muted tones and the extensive use of local timber and stone, perfectly complementing the setting.
The 19th century Lake Hotel stands on the shore of the Lake of Menteith and is an hour's drive from Glasgow and Edinburgh. With wonderful views from the dining room, lunch is a most delightful experience with a combination of skilled Scottish cooking and a delightful view.
The food matches the surroundings and one can expect to find wonderful two and three course meals with seared West Coast scallop with smoked mousseline, artichoke, horseradish and green apple or pan roast breast of Perthshire pigeon on mixed bean cassoulet and smoked pancetta for starters and rump of Dornie Hill lamb on braised cabbage with spring greens and port wine jus or steamed brown trout with beetroot dauphinoise, wild garlic puree and vermouth beurre blanc for mains.
The dessert list comprises of a tempting nougatine parfait with chocolate tart and blood orange marmalade and a selection of British and Continental cheeses served with oatcakes, spicy grape chutney, apple and celery.

Callander Meadows
24 Main Street, Callander, FK17 8B [Map]
Callander in Perthshire is itself an attractive town situated at the confluence of two rivers in an area of outstanding natural beauty known as the Trossachs on the edge of the Scottish Highlands. The scenic surroundings combined with the numbers and variety of lochs and rivers make this a natural playground for visitors from all over the world.
Callander Meadows, a family run establishment situated in Scotland's First National Park reveals itself as a beautiful town house built around 1800, full of charm and character and retaining many features.
The restaurant serves locally sourced seasonal food cooked simply with care and attention and has been awarded an AA Rosette for the consistent high standard food and wine in a welcoming atmosphere.
The dining area is a charming cross between a French Bistro and a Scottish country house. Tartan curtains and a roaring log fire provide the Scottish touch and chalk boards with French quotations and a wall of bottles of wine add the Gallic influence.

The Lade Inn
Kilmahog, Callander, FK17 8HD [Map]
Mealtimes at the Lade Inn are invariably a cheerful affair. Reinvigorated by the bracing country air and exercise, if indeed cycling or walking is your thing, be ready to go the whole hog with such classic fare as battered haggis balls with whisky sauce, Scottish smoked salmon, haggis, neeps and tatties, pan fried breast of Fife chicken, homemade beef steak and Lade Inn real ale pie, whole baked Trossachs trout, homemade shepherd's pie or sirloin steak with whole tomatoes and mushrooms. There's also Moroccan spiced lamb tagine, chicken goujons and penne pasta for variety. Top a hearty meal with fresh raspberry cranachan, old fashioned sticky toffee pudding or double chocolate fudge cake. Drive back home satisfied that home cooking never tasted so good.
